WebApr 20, 2024 · Official answer. There are no known interactions between Azithromycin (Zithromax Z-Pak) and alcohol so you could take a glass or two if you wanted to. In general, drinking any amount of alcohol while fighting an infection may not be wise, as it can lead to dehydration, interrupt normal sleep, and may hinder the body’s natural ability … WebSep 16, 2024 · Below are the effects of mixing alcohol and azithromycin. 1. Headache. One of the side effects of azithromycin is a headache. When taken in high dosages, it can cause the head to throb, especially if someone fails to drink enough water. When you combine alcohol and azithromycin, the risk of headaches occurring increases.

WebFeb 13, 2024 · As long as it is prescribed by a doctor for bacterial infections, azithromycin is generally safe and effective. Neither it nor alcohol interact directly with each other. In other words, most people could drink moderate amounts of alcohol while taking the drug without any serious consequences. WebDec 13, 2024 · A Z-Pack (also called a Z-Pak, Zmax, or Zithromax) is literally just azithromycin, a standard antibiotic introduced in 1992, formulated in a package of six pills, which are taken over five days ...
